Shana

Offered for sale in the Pacific Northwest, Shana is a rare and remarkable 107-foot custom motor yacht built by Northwest Workboats of Seattle and designed by renowned naval architect Glade Johnson. Conceived as a long-range expedition yacht with commercial-grade integrity, Shana stands out for her all-aluminum construction—crafted from 5086 and 5053 marine-grade plate—and for her commanding presence, originally purpose-built for an experienced yachtsman with no compromises on quality or capability.

Her displacement hull and robust 330,000 lb build are powered by twin Detroit Diesel 16V92 TA engines delivering 1,400 horsepower each, overhauled just 500 hours ago to professional standards. Backed by Detroit V-drives, oversized bronze props, Naiad stabilizers, and a 16″ hydraulic bow thruster, she is engineered for serious coastal passage-making.

The use of aluminum not only gives Shana exceptional structural integrity and longevity but also reduces maintenance compared to traditional fiberglass yachts.

Designed and constructed in the Pacific Northwest for its demanding conditions, this yacht is a unique fusion of expedition toughness and luxury yachting, offering a platform that is rarely duplicated in today’s marketplace. With systems and capabilities that rival commercial vessels, and a pedigree grounded in one of the world’s great yachtbuilding regions, Shana is a standout vessel for owners seeking true seaworthiness, legacy design, and unshakable performance.

Hull Construction & Design

  • Builder: Northwest Workboats, Seattle, WA (completed 1990)

  • Designer: Glade Johnson

  • Naval Architect: Guido Perla

  • Type: Displacement Motor Yacht

  • Material: Marine-grade aluminum (5086 & 5053 plate)

  • Thicknesses :

    • Hull sides:  1/2″

    • Bottom:  3/4″

    • Decks:  5/16″ teak over aluminum

    • Superstructure: 1/4″

  • Bulkheads: spec list shows 4 watertight bulkheads, not mentioned in survey

  • Dimensions: LOA 107′, Beam 26′, Draft 10′

  • Displacement: ~330,000 lbs

  • Tonnage: 174 gross, 52 net

  • Finish: Survey confirms teak decks, but Awlgrip (2015) and Seahawk Tropicote bottom (2017)

Engines & Propulsion

  • Main Engines: Twin Detroit Diesel 16V92 TA, 1,400 HP each (2,800 HP total), under 1000 hours

  • Transmissions: Twin Disc DD6619RV V-Drives, ratio 2.5:1

  • Shafts & Props: 4.5″ Aquamet 22 stainless shafts with 5-blade bronze Veem props

  • Exhaust & Cooling: Wet exhaust, freshwater heat exchanger cooling

  • Stabilizers: Naiad with 16 sq. ft fins

  • Thruster: 16″ hydraulic bow thruster (PTO off genset + electric backup)

  • Controls: Mathers CH5 pneumatic 4-station engine control
